Best Quotes about Friends and friendship

1.
Friendship is an arrangement by which we undertake to exchange small favors for big ones.
Montesquieu, Charles De

2.
A mirror reflects a man's face, but what he is really like is shown by the kind of friends he chooses. [Proverbs 27:19]
Bible

3.
I desire to so conduct the affairs of this administration that if at the end, when I come to lay down the reins of power, I have lost every other friend on earth, I shall at least have one friend left, and that friend shall be down inside of me.
Lincoln, Abraham

4.
Friends will keep you sane, Love could fill your heart, A lover can warm your bed, But lonely is the soul without a mate.
Pratt, David

5.
With true friends... even water drunk together is sweet enough.
Proverb, Chinese

6.
God gives us our relatives -- thank God we can choose our friends.
Mumford, Ethel Watts

7.
Plant a seed of friendship; reap a bouquet of happiness.
Kaufman, Lois L.

8.
A friend is someone you can be alone with and have nothing to do and not be able to think of anything to say and be comfortable in the silence.
Condie, Sheryl

9.
The greatest healing therapy is friendship and love.
Humphrey, Hubert H.

10.
Show me a friend in need and I'll show you a pest.
Lewis, Joe E.

11.
A good friend who points out mistakes and imperfections and rebukes evil is to be respected as if he reveals a secret of hidden treasure.
Buddha

12.
If you have no enemies you are apt to be in the same predicament in regard to friends.
Hubbard, Elbert

13.
If a man does not make new acquaintances as he advances through life, he will soon find himself left alone; one should keep his friendships in constant repair.
Johnson, Samuel

14.
Don't walk in front of me, I may not follow; Don't walk behind me, I may not lead; Walk beside me, and just be my friend.
Camus, Albert

15.
If a man urge me to tell wherefore I loved him, I feel it cannot be expressed but by answering: Because it was he, because it was myself.
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De

16.
A home-made friend wears longer than one you buy in the market.
O'Malley, Austin

17.
Love is blind; friendship closes its eyes.

18.
The worst solitude is to have no real friendships.
Bacon, Francis

19.
A true friend is somebody who can make us do what we can.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

20.
When you face a crisis, you know who your true friends are.
Johnson, Earvin ''Magic''

21.
The rule of friendship means there should be mutual sympathy between them, each supplying what the other lacks and trying to benefit the other, always using friendly and sincere words.
Buddha

22.
A true friend is someone who is there for you when he'd rather be anywhere else.
Wein, Len

23.
However much we guard ourselves against it, we tend to shape ourselves in the image others have of us. It is not so much the example of others we imitate, as the reflection of ourselves in their eyes and the echo of ourselves in their words.
Hoffer, Eric

24.
A true friend is one who overlooks your failures and tolerates your successes.
Larson, Doug

25.
I want my friend to miss me as long as I miss him.
Augustine, St.

26.
Friendship is to be purchased only by friendship. A man may have authority over others, but he can never have their hearts but by giving his own.
Wilson, Thomas

27.
Friend -- One who knows all about you and likes you just the same

28.
You have been my friends, replied Charlotte, that in itself is a tremendous thing...
White, Elwyn Brooks

29.
It takes a long time to grow an old friend.
Leonard, John

30.
Many merry Christmases, friendships, great accumulation of cheerful recollections, affection on earth, and Heaven at last for all of us.
Dickens, Charles

31.
It's funny, isn't it? How your best friend can just blow up like that?
Python, Monty

32.
I am already kindly disposed towards you. My friendship it is not in my power to give: this is a gift which no man can make, it is not in our own power: a sound and healthy friendship is the growth of time and circumstance, it will spring up and thrive like a wildflower when these favour, and when they do not, it is in vain to look for it.
Wordsworth, William

33.
A ray of sunshine, a balmy breeze Are a gift from God above, And He also gives us faithful friends. To warm our hearts with love.

34.
Every deed and every relationship is surrounded by an atmosphere of silence. Friendship needs no words -- it is solitude delivered from the anguish of loneliness.
Hammarskjold, Dag

35.
In the adversity of our best friends we often find something that does not displease us.
Young, Brigham

36.
Friendship is a precious gift. To give at Christmas time. A Cherished gift, a treasured gift that lasts through all time.

37.
I have a friend who tells a tale With statements parenthetical; To start at the beginning must To her seem quite heretical; For her accounts of happenings Are full of disconnection s; She starts them in the middle, And proceeds in all directions.
Stux, Erica H.

38.
Good friends are good for your health.
Sarason, Irwin

39.
Old friends pass away, new friends appear. It is just like the days. An old day passes, a new day arrives. The important thing is to make it meaningful: a meaningful friend -- or a meaningful day.
Dalai Lama

40.
Friendship's the privilege of private men; for wretched greatness knows no blessing so substantial.
Tate, Nahum

41.
From quiet homes and first beginning, out to the undiscovered ends, there's nothing worth the wear of winning, but laughter and the love of friends.
Belloc, Hilaire

42.
One friend in a lifetime is much, two are many, three are hardly possible. Friendship needs a certain parallelism of life, a community of thought, a rivalry of aim.
Adams, Henry Brooks

43.
The most violent friendships soonest wear themselves out.
Hazlitt, William

44.
When friendship disappears then there is a space left open to that awful loneliness of the outside world which is like the cold space between the planets. It is an air in which men perish utterly.
Belloc, Hilaire

45.
Friendship is genuine when two friends can enjoy each others company without speaking a word to one another.
Ebers, George

46.
A friend is long sought, hardly found, and with difficulty kept.
Jerome, St.

47.
Your notions of friendship are new to me; I believe every man is born with his quantum, and he cannot give to one without robbing another. I very well know to whom I would give the first place in my friendship, but they are not in the way, I am condemned to another scene, and therefore I distribute it in pennyworths to those about me, and who displease me least, and should do the same to my fellow prisoners if I were condemned to a jail.
Swift, Jonathan

48.
Only your real friends will tell you when your face is dirty.
Proverb, Sicilian

49.
One of the surest evidences of friendship that one individual can display to another is telling him gently of a fault. If any other can excel it, it is listening to such a disclosure with gratitude, and amending the error.
Bulwer-Lytton, Edward G.

50.
To say that a man is your Friend, means commonly no more than this, that he is not your enemy. Most contemplate only what would be the accidental and trifling advantages of Friendship, as that the Friend can assist in time of need by his substance, or his influence, or his counsel. Even the utmost goodwill and harmony and practical kindness are not sufficient for Friendship, for Friends do not live in harmony merely, as some say, but in melody.
Thoreau, Henry David
